BONAVENTURA Customer Support
Email address: service@mybonaventura.com
Address: 5201 Great America Pkwy STE 320
Santa Clara,
CA 95054, US
Please allow 1-2 business days for a reply(except Saturdays and Sundays).

FAQ: click here